Walk and See

Cut colored paper into shapes - a rectangle, circle, square and triangle and put it into a Ziploc bag.  Go on a walk with your child and ask him to choose a piece of paper.  Ask him to point out an item of that color or shape to you.  Encourage him to describe the item he spotted.

With this activity you have taught your child how to look at things carefully and that objects around us are of different shapes. Roofs are like triangles, car tires are circles, windows are rectangles, and so on.
